Output 8b759dc94ecc3668b79cf07a6de8a16e40e074f76117e11e947615b66e4bdc59:43

value
577204
script pubkey
OP_0 OP_PUSHBYTES_20 40e07d5133fa94ab2f64fee7dfa191085ced7df0
address
bc1qgrs865fnl222ktmylmnalgv3ppww6l0s9jggem
transaction
8b759dc94ecc3668b79cf07a6de8a16e40e074f76117e11e947615b66e4bdc59
spent
true